A mother and father were arrested in Smith County, Texas, on Monday morning for allegedly hiding fentanyl pills inside their baby’s diaper.
A deputy pulled over the pair for a traffic stop near a 7-Eleven with their six-month-old in the backseat, according to the Smith County Sheriff’s Office. During the traffic stop, the deputy allegedly smelled marijuana and conducted a probable cause search of the car, the report states.
Smith County Sheriff’s Office Public Information Officer Sgt. Larry Christian told KLTV that while the deputy is 99 percent sure the pills contain fentanyl, they will be sent to a lab for testing. He pointed out that hiding fentanyl in the child’s diaper could have caused a fatal accident.
